Why Retaining Walls Are Important

Retaining walls do more than add visual appeal to your property. They provide structural support by holding back soil and preventing slope erosion. Without a properly functioning retaining wall, shifting soil can damage landscaping, patios, walkways, and even nearby foundations.

When these walls begin to fail, the problem rarely stays small. Small cracks, bulges, or leaning sections can quickly turn into major structural issues if left unaddressed.

How Winter Weather Makes Problems Worse

Cold weather can be particularly hard on retaining walls. As moisture enters small cracks or gaps in the structure, freezing temperatures cause the water to expand. This freeze-thaw cycle puts pressure on the wall, which can lead to further cracking, shifting, or complete structural failure.

Heavy snow and melting ice also increase water saturation in the surrounding soil, adding additional pressure behind the wall. If repairs are delayed until spring, damage may become more extensive and costly.

Signs Your Retaining Wall Needs Repair

Before winter arrives, it is important to inspect your retaining wall for warning signs of deterioration. Common issues include:

  • Cracks in the wall or mortar joints

  • Bulging or leaning sections

  • Loose or displaced stones or blocks

  • Drainage problems or pooling water

  • Soil erosion around the base

If you notice any of these signs, scheduling a professional inspection can help prevent further damage.
